DISTINGUISHED PROFESSOR

 

To promote the scholarship of teaching, the Center supports the Distinguished Professor Award, which is funded by Title III. The successful candidate will receive a budget of $28,000 to implement his/her approved plans to improve teaching and learning on campus.

CRITERIA

  • Any full-time faculty member is eligible to receive the award.
  • Nomination for the award can be made directly by the faculty member, by other faculty or administrators, or by students.
  • Nominated faculty must provide the committee with the following:
    • A summary of the previous twenty-four (24) months' activities in vita form
    • Student evaluations for the previous academic year.
    • The nominee's previous year's performance evaluation
    • Two (2) letters of recommendation from either faculty or administrators.
    • A letter to the committee addressing the following:
      • A definition of teaching excellence
      • Evidence that the nominee has presented instruction consistent with his/her definition of teaching excellence
      • A description of any innovative approaches to teaching that the nominee has used, along with any enhancements planned for future use.
      • Any use of technology for enhanced teaching effectiveness previously used and/or planned for future use.
      • Plans for conducting symposiums, workshops, etc. consistent with requirements of the position.  These do not need to be specific with regard to timing, but need to address issues such as frequency of presentations and the expected scope of the activities.
